Q: Is 77,565,381 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 77,565,381 is a composite number.

Why is 77,565,381 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 77,565,381 can be evenly divided by 1 3 109 327 237,203 711,609 25,855,127 and 77,565,381, with no remainder.

Since 77,565,381 cannot be divided by just 1 and 77,565,381, it is a composite number.
